TIMESTAMPS
Eyeshadow with primer : 0:59
Eyeshadow without primer : 4:20
Eyeshadow with concealer : 5:46
Eyeshadow with too much concealer : 9:18
Eyeshadow with concealer + translucent powder : 10:40
Eyeshadow with concealer + bone coloured eyeshadow : 13:10
Eyeshadow with too much concealer + too much bone coloured eyeshadow : 16:01
Product recommendations : 17:34

Put concealer under the eye primer in very small amounts. I hate the eye primer I have it doesn't cancel out any darkness, it doesn't blend and it can get cakey real quick. What it dies do is stop creasing dead in its tracks if you don't set the concealer, the oil from the concealer breaks down your eyeshadow or it just let's you natural lid oil through. The eye primer or translucent powder is blocking the oil. A normal eyeshadow or normal powder is not designed to block oil or moisture.
Try a white eyeshadow powder instead of white concealer. Or I think Mac (paint point?) and Nyx do a white eyeshadow base. I think the primer is OK at stopping creasing of the shadow but yes if you need colours to pop then it's a pigment problem.
